Trusts

Nolo can help you make a revocable living trust to avoid probate, saving your estate time and money. With Nolo's Living Trust or Quicken WillMaker, you can make an individual trust for yourself or a shared trust with your spouse. Or if you prefer to put together your trust yourself, use Denis Clifford’s best-selling Make Your Own Living Trust. It is a time-tested trust (individual or shared) that comes with downloadable forms and a through explanation of how trusts work and why you probably want one.

If you’re interested in special needs trusts, take a look at Special Needs Trusts, by Michele Fuller and Kevin Urbatsch. It explains in plain English how keeping a separate trust for people with special needs can protects their public benefits and safeguards their financial future. It also explains how to write a special needs trust using the book’s downloadable forms.
